Psalm : Ps 24 (23)
R// Such is the people that seeks your face, O Lord.
Of David
24:1 To Yahweh belong earth and all it holds, the world and all who live in it;
24:2 he himself founded it on the ocean, based it firmly on the nether sea
24:3 Who has the right to climb the mountain of Yahweh, who the right to stand in his holy place?
24:4 He whose hands are clean, whose heart is pure, whose soul does not pay homage to worthless things and who never swears to a lie.
24:5 The blessing of Yahweh is his, and Vindication from God his saviour.
24:6 Such are the people who seek him, who seek your presence, God of Jacob! (pause)
24:7 Gates, raise your arches, rise, you ancient doors, let the king of glory in!
24:8 Who is this king of glory? Yahweh the strong, the valiant, Yahweh valiant in battle!
24:9 Gates, raise your arches, rise you ancient doors, let the king of glory in!
24:10 Who is this king of glory? He is Yahweh Sabaoth, King of glory, he! (pause)
Gospel : Lk 21, 1-4
The widow’s mite
21:1 As he looked up he saw rich people putting their, offerings into the treasury;
21:2 then he happened to notice a poverty-stricken widow putting in two small coins,
21:3 and he said, ‘I tell you truly, this poor widow has put in more than any of them;
21:4 for these have all contributed money they had over, but she from the little she had has put in all she had to live on.
